About agriculture in El Negro

El Negro is situated in the southeastern region of Puerto Rico, within the municipality of Yabucoa. This area is characterized by its lush, tropical landscape, nestled between the Caribbean coast and the verdant slopes of the Cuchilla de Panduras. The rural surroundings feature a mix of fertile coastal plains and rolling hills, typical of the island’s vibrant ecological diversity.

The agricultural heart of Yabucoa, including the El Negro sector, is traditionally focused on tropical crops. Plantains and bananas are among the most prominent staples grown here, benefiting from the region's rich soil and abundant rainfall. Additionally, local farms often engage in small-scale vegetable production and livestock grazing, maintaining the area's long-standing agrarian identity.
